HR DESIGN PRINCIPLES


COMMENT

The development  and articulation of design principles for HR  provides clarity and focus about the intent and value of HR in an organisation.

The principles provide context for best practice set in the organisational context and stage of evolution.They enable all stakeholders to understand the driving force and set a common theme for people to work to and play a part in delivering overall strategy.

Typical principles identify the need for:

  • An integrated approach
  • Flexibility and adaptability to enable change
  • Accountability
  • Commercial awareness and acumen
  • Focus on client/customer needs
  • Continuous improvement /Best Practice
  • Innovation
  • Development of line management capability
